Quick summary
Tyrian 2000 revives the classic arcade shooter with modern polish. It’s a fast-paced, level-based shoot ’em up where the goal is to blast through waves of enemies while progressing through stages and upgrading your craft.
Core gameplay and loop
- Fast, arcade-style shooting with continuous enemy encounters and level objectives.
- Players earn money and resources by completing stages and defeating foes.
- Progression rewards give access to new weapons and ship enhancements that keep gameplay fresh.
Weaponry and loadout customization
- Side weapon hardpoints, rear-mounted weapons, and forward-facing guns allow varied setups.
- Purchaseable modules and upgrades let you tailor your ship to suit aggressive, defensive, or balanced playstyles.
- Combining different weapon types creates strategic loadouts for tougher encounters.
